Requirements

Candidates must be enrolled in their 3rd year of university studies in Accounting or Business Administration, possess an advanced level of English, and be proficient in Excel, PowerPoint, and Word, including basic functions. They should have a basic understanding of accounting principles or forecasting concepts, no more than 1 year of professional experience in accounting/finance, and a commitment to participate in the program for at least 12 months. This is an entry-level position.

Responsibilities

The Finance Development Program participant will support basic month-end close processes and journal entries using Oracle and OBIEE. They will prepare monthly reconciliations, assist with ad hoc requests for revenue/cost reporting and analysis, and create basic standardization and efficiencies across financial reporting and analysis models. Responsibilities also include supporting basic monthly end-to-end processes for the department, adhering to service level agreements and performance metrics, and creating desktop procedure documents for routine processes.

About Expedia

Expedia Group operates in the travel industry, offering a wide range of services for travelers and travel-related businesses. It connects users with options for flights, hotels, car rentals, vacation packages, and activities through its various brands, including Expedia, Hotels.com, and Vrbo. Travelers can easily find and book trips that match their preferences and budgets. The company earns revenue primarily through commissions on bookings and advertising from travel service providers looking to promote their offerings. Additionally, Expedia Group supports its partners by providing access to valuable data and technology, helping them improve their operations and grow their businesses. The goal of Expedia Group is to create a seamless travel experience for users while maximizing the potential of its partners.
